Kamloopa Pow Wow


The Kamloopa Pow Wow is one of the largest celebrations of First Nations' culture and heritage in Western Canada.

The Pow Wow is a spectacular expression of the Secwepemc people's heritage and is a vibrant display
of storytelling, song and dance in traditional regalia.

Every summer, the Kamloopa Pow Wow brings together 1,300 performers, competitors, arts and crafts people,
and more than 15,000 spectators to this three-day annual First Nations event in Kamloops.
Organized by the Tk'emlups te Secwepemc, the powwow is one of Canada's most unique cultural experiences and a
whole lot of fun, combining athletic competitions, singing, dancing, and food as more than 30 bands from Western Canada
and the Northern US gather for the event.

The powwow, held on the August long weekend, is set in a large, wooden, circular open-air stadium arbor next to the
Secwepemc Museum and Heritage Park.
